For cult comedy lovers everywhere, it may be the news that could make you wet your intergalactic pants.
Rumours abound that sci-fi comedy Red Dwarf may make a comeback on TV after a ten year hiatus.
The series, which was resurrected last year for a one-off three-episode mini-series may make a permanent comeback after Chris Barrie (who plays Rimmer on the show) told The Daily Record that he was keen for the show to continue after the success of the mini-series.
“There is talk of more Red Dwarf this year and while Back to Earth was a good one-off, from the rumours I hear, we may be doing a more standard sort of series," Barrie said. “But any new Red Dwarf is fine by me. I was surprised at just how quickly I slipped back into it. It took a couple of scenes to loosen up a bit but once you get the outfit on, you're there.
“I don't know what made the series work so well, I think the answer must be Doug Naylor. He's a genius. He is well-versed in the sci-fi world and he and Rob Grant were great comedy writers, so I think Red Dwarf is the dream marriage of those two things.”
